Introduction

The  capability  of  assistive  technology  in  education  classes  for  students  with  special needs is enormous. Some of the advantages of using technology include promoting academic success for students with disabilities in the field of writing, mathematics, spelling, reading and comprehension, enhancing their organizing capability and most importantly encouraging their social inclusion in society (Quenneville, 2015). Support or assistive  technology offers many  advantages  by  assisting writing  for  students with disabilities who  usually  find writing  to be cumbersome  (MacArthur,  2006).  Once  students  overcome  writing  issues,  they  tend  to  be more successful within the general  education  environment. Also most of learners with disability find  it challenging  to  retain  information  from  the  standard  syllabus. Many  teachers  face difficulty adapting  curriculum  as  per  the  learning  requirements  of  children  with certain disabilities like learning disabilities and intellectual disabilities without  any external assistance. Hence, it has become all the more important to focus on this issue to help teachers incorporate technology within the classroom to promote learning of learners with special needs (Wilson & Cleland., 2011).
